Output 9e5766df6dd5c8def93bd04c5fd5cd3901be99dc75184dbe8319996e16400c52:21

value
10599883
script pubkey
OP_0 OP_PUSHBYTES_20 96afb893d77a6bf8a855cfef93e87a5cdb376569
address
bc1qj6hm3y7h0f4l32z4elhe86r6tndnwetfxamyz3
transaction
9e5766df6dd5c8def93bd04c5fd5cd3901be99dc75184dbe8319996e16400c52
spent
true